Full screen problems I use vista 64 + sp1 with a 16:9 display and bsplayer 2.35. First I had the problem when i switched to full screen mode the movie was enlarged way too much so i could see only a small part of it. I found solution in another topic: pressing 5 on numeric. Problem seemed to be solved but now its still not perfect: If I go full screen the top and the bottom of the movie touches the edge and the two sides are off the screen. I have to press either 5 or the M twice for the sides to be adjusted to the screen. I have "cut top and bottom.." and "allow video window off screen" disabled and "remember pan-scan settings" enabled. Can anyone help me how to solve the problem? Thank you in advance. |
I think that you should enable "cut top and bottom...". Or press shift + 2 |
thanks fot the tip but unfortunetly it didnt work uninstalled then reinstalled bsplayer and now its working properly |
